Much to the merriment and rejoicing of his supporters, Kamal Haasan on Wednesday launched his party by hoisting a flag and announcing the party's name as Makkal Needhi Maiam, which literally translates to People's Justice Party.

Kamal started off his speech by greeting the masses and giving a special mention to the important office holders of his party. Acknowledging their hard work for over three decades of hard work for society through welfare clubs, Kamal also brought to the audience's attention why the leap into politics was essential.

Kamal also expressed his gratitude to Arvind Kejriwal stating that the latter had helped kick-start his campaign already. He also recalled how Andhra Pradesh CM Chandrababu Naidu's words of encouragement helped him. Further Kamal also strongly stressed he wasn't a leader, but rather a cadre, fellow party member, a mere representative and tool to enable people's welfare.

Quality education to all, the abolition of caste and corruption were some of the key goals he pointed out towards which his party will work. He also said he will not give way to bribe people with money for votes and advised the people against it as well. Other key areas that Kamal's discourse gave importance was employment to youngsters, adoption of villages and even resolving the Cauvery Water issue, stating that any problem could be solved with the right talk and approach.

Furthermore, the Universal Star also explained the meaning behind his party symbol. The six hands denote the six south Indian states, while the center star denotes the people. Thus, his party is one which doesn't lean right or left politically but vested in people's welfare as the center spot.

Kamal also strongly impressed upon the audience the fact that how privatizing education sector has ended up reducing its quality as much as taking control of liquor which could be done by anybody.
